Pаrticipаnt instructiоns fоr the LAT exаm This LAT assessment is an impоrtant part of the CLC exam and is one of the required competencies to pass. Please note that not all assessment elements will be seen on the video clips. You will only be graded on the elements that are clearly visible in the video clips. We will watch a short video clip of a feeding. The video will be played a total of 3 times, with 3 minutes between each viewing to make notes on your LAT Assessment Tool. After the third viewing and final 3-minute assessment period, you will be instructed to begin the True/False exam. You will have 4 additional minutes to answer the 10 questions under “LAT 1.” You should refer to your notes on the Assessment Tool when answering the True/False questions.
